Safety Gear Custom Power Distribution for Emergency Sites
Safe and Sound…
Problem: A local distributor of Safety products for Firefighters and Emergency Personnel wanted a small distribution unit for connection to the emergency generators for powering their “tent city”. It must be rugged, rain proof and easily transportable. GFCI and circuit breaker protection were a must in the very wet environment.
Solution: Ericson designed a mini distribution unit for our friends at US Safety Gear while meeting all his requirements. The use of our Perma-Tite2 plugs and connectors as well as our FS flip covers ensured a dry and safe electrical source. ...
